Can jumping rope improve postpartum urine leakage

Jumping rope does not generally improve postpartum urine leakage and may worsen it. Some women experience urinary leakage after childbirth, which is usually caused by the relaxation of the pelvic floor muscles. Some people think that jumping rope can improve urine leakage, but in fact, this kind of exercise can hardly improve urine leakage. The pressure in the abdominal cavity increases when people do rope skipping, which not only makes it difficult to improve urinary leakage, but also often leads to worsening of urinary leakage symptoms. If a woman has obvious urine leakage after childbirth, she can improve it by doing more anal lifting exercises. By insisting on doing anal lifting exercises, you can effectively exercise the muscles of the pelvic floor, increase the tension of the pelvic floor, and improve the phenomenon of urine leakage. If the phenomenon of urine leakage after delivery is more serious, it is difficult to play a role through simple exercise, should consult a doctor in time.
